As our Manufacturing Engineer, you will support the design, development, and optimisation of production and assembly lines for all our aircraft seating programmes for new and existing products as well supporting the day-to-day activities and running of our assembly production line. Working closely with Design Engineering, Quality, Supply Chain, and Production teams, you will ensure efficient, repeatable, and high-quality manufacturing processes are developed and maintained.

YOUR M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Provide day-to-day engineering support to the production environment
  • Develop, improve, and optimise manufacturing processes to ensure efficiency, quality, and repeatability
  • Support the manufacture of carbon fibre components
  • Assist in compression moulding processes, including operation and optimisation of heated hydraulic presses
  • Ensure correct handling, storage, and preparation of composite materials in line with process requirements
  • Interpret and work from engineering drawings, specifications, and technical documentation
  • Support the design and implementation of tooling, jigs, and fixtures
  • Assist with new product introduction (NPI) activities, including process development, validation, and documentation
  • Identify and implement continuous improvement initiatives (lean manufacturing, waste reduction, efficiency improvements)
  • Support root cause analysis and problem-solving for production issues
  • Ensure compliance with health & safety, quality, and regulatory standards
  • Create and maintain work instructions and manufacturing documentation
  • Collaborate closely with design, quality, and production teams to ensure manufacturability and smooth production flow

About you:

To help Mirus continue our journey of growth, you will bring your expertise within a manufacturing engineering capacity, a passion for innovation, problem solving abilities and drive for operational excellence along with the following skills, experience, qualifications and attributes:

  • Technical experience in Manufacturing Engineering, with a professional qualification (university degree) and/or background in engineering (Aerospace, Mechanical) or a relevant (IMechE) or (IET) qualification / Apprenticeship or equivalent vocational training.
  • Exposure to NPI (New Product Introduction) activities
  • Understanding of carbon fibre composites, particularly prepreg systems
  • Basic knowledge of compression moulding processes, ideally using heated hydraulic presses
  • Ability to interpret engineering drawings and technical specifications
  • Awareness of manufacturing process control and quality requirements
  • Understanding of tooling, layup techniques, and manufacturing principles
  • Familiarity with lean manufacturing and continuous improvement concepts

Desirable:

  • Experience in aerospace or other regulated manufacturing environments
  • Experience working with composite manufacturing processes in industry
  • Knowledge of composite defect modes and inspection techniques
  • Familiarity with process validation and documentation
  • Awareness of DFM/A (Design for Manufacture and Assembly) principles
  • Experience with ERP/MRP systems or manufacturing software
